# Break-Glass: Catalog Cache Invalidation

Scope: the Pinrow product catalog at Veldstone Retail. If stale prices persist after a purge and the Hollowmere invalidation queue is wedged, use break-glass to flush the edge tier directly. Contractors: get verbal sign-off from the catalog lead first. Steps: open the Hollowmere admin shell, select emergency-flush, confirm the tenant, and run it once — repeated flushes thrash the origin. Access is logged and expires after 20 minutes. Unseal the admin shell with the passphrase below.

recovery phrase for kahop-tajog: istix-casvan

Board Briefing — Capacity Decision, Verdane Works

The Harlow Ridge plant is operating at 94% utilisation, and demand forecasts for the Calyra line suggest we exceed capacity by Q3 next year. Options under review: a second shift at Harlow Ridge, expansion of the Mersfield annex, or contract manufacturing through Toverin Fabrication. Capital estimates range from 4.2M to 11.8M, with payback periods between three and six years. The committee's preliminary recommendation is outlined in the confidential note below.

board note of kageg-bahof: The renewal with Holwynax Holdings closes at $2 million a year, 5 percent below the last contract. Project Ulaath slips by two quarters because of the supplier delay.

Wikloom enforces role-based access per namespace. Roles: reader, editor, steward. Stewards can reassign roles via PATCH /namespaces/{id}/roles; editors cannot escalate. Role checks happen at request time, not session start, so revocations apply immediately. For the sync demo against the Brindlemoor staging instance, authenticate with the bearer token below.

session JWT of yawep-yawep = eyJhbGciOiJIUzI1NiIsInR5cCI6IkpXVCJ9.eyJzdWIiOiI3pWF3_In0.aXYsHiog